Gravity's Rainbow is an epic postmodern novel written by Thomas Pynchon and first published on February 28, 1973. It is widely regarded as Pynchon's magnum opus . WebAbout the Title. The title Gravity's Rainbow refers to the arc of the German V-2 rocket in flight. The Germans used the V-2 weapon during World War II. Fuel propels the V-2 rocket up and then gravity pulls it down, creating a curved path.
